Cal Crutc🌠hlow has said that his injured left ankle is both fractured and dislocated.

A Saturday evening statement from his Yamaha Tech 3 teamꦕ, following the morning practice fall, appeared to rule out any fractures:

"Extensive analysis of the [hospital] scans has revealed the former World Supersport Champion hasn't suffered an꧃y fractures and he is already able to put weight on his left foot after doctors reduced🎃 the swelling around his heel and ankle."

But after passing🌞 a medical check and completing Sunday's Silverstone warm-up, Crutchlow wrote on Twitter:

"Full♌ exℱtent of injury is I have a broken and dislocated left ankle. It's back in place now but worst pain I've had so will try my best in race."

Crutc൲hlow, w♒ho missed last year's British GP with a broken collarbone, set the tenth fastest lap in warm-up. He will start from 20th and last on the grid after missing qualifying.
